Transaction 669c5976e2d7365dc751c119f8161cd878540374bd88d98c7cb7954e0afea823
1 Input
1 Output
-
669c5976e2d7365dc751c119f8161cd878540374bd88d98c7cb7954e0afea823:0
- value
- 1585691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46aa6b310889b6ab1b3e5002f821aae635f8f718 OP_EQUAL
- address
- 388fNsXPvMmTC8evznrVq55frgNGWunoYD